2 definitions
improvise (Verb) —   Perform without preparation 1 example
1. ex. "he improvised a speech at the wedding"
improvise (Verb) —   Manage in a makeshift way; do with whatever is at hand 1 example
1. ex. "after the hurricane destroyed our house, we had to improvise for weeks"
